- //
- // serial_port.cpp
- // ~~~~~~~~~~~~~~~
- //
- // Copyright (c) 2003-2019 Christopher M. Kohlhoff (chris at kohlhoff dot com)
- // Copyright (c) 2008 Rep Invariant Systems, Inc. (info@repinvariant.com)
- //
- // Distributed under the Boost Software License, Version 1.0. (See accompanying
- // file LICENSE_1_0.txt or copy at http://www.boost.org/LICENSE_1_0.txt)
- //
- // Disable autolinking for unit tests.
- #if !defined(BOOST_ALL_NO_LIB)
- #define BOOST_ALL_NO_LIB 1
- #endif // !defined(BOOST_ALL_NO_LIB)
- // Test that header file is self-contained.
- #include <boost/asio/serial_port.hpp>
- #include "archetypes/async_result.hpp"
- #include <boost/asio/io_context.hpp>
- #include "unit_test.hpp"
- //------------------------------------------------------------------------------
- // serial_port_compile test
- // ~~~~~~~~~~~~~~~~~~~~~~~~~~
- // The following test checks that all public member functions on the class
- // serial_port compile and link correctly. Runtime failures are ignored.
- namespace serial_port_compile {
- struct write_some_handler
- {
- write_some_handler() {}
- void operator()(const boost::system::error_code&, std::size_t) {}
- #if defined(BOOST_ASIO_HAS_MOVE)
- write_some_handler(write_some_handler&&) {}
- private:
- write_some_handler(const write_some_handler&);
- #endif // defined(BOOST_ASIO_HAS_MOVE)
- };
- struct read_some_handler
- {
- read_some_handler() {}
- void operator()(const boost::system::error_code&, std::size_t) {}
- #if defined(BOOST_ASIO_HAS_MOVE)
- read_some_handler(read_some_handler&&) {}
- private:
- read_some_handler(const read_some_handler&);
- #endif // defined(BOOST_ASIO_HAS_MOVE)
- };
- void test()
- {
- #if defined(BOOST_ASIO_HAS_SERIAL_PORT)
- using namespace boost::asio;
- try
- {
- io_context ioc;
- const io_context::executor_type ioc_ex = ioc.get_executor();
- char mutable_char_buffer[128] = "";
- const char const_char_buffer[128] = "";
- serial_port::baud_rate serial_port_option;
- archetypes::lazy_handler lazy;
- boost::system::error_code ec;
- // basic_serial_port constructors.
- serial_port port1(ioc);
- serial_port port2(ioc, "null");
- serial_port::native_handle_type native_port1 = port1.native_handle();
- #if defined(BOOST_ASIO_MSVC) && (_MSC_VER < 1910)
- // Skip this on older MSVC due to mysterious ambiguous overload errors.
- #else
- serial_port port3(ioc, native_port1);
- #endif
- serial_port port4(ioc_ex);
- serial_port port5(ioc_ex, "null");
- serial_port::native_handle_type native_port2 = port1.native_handle();
- serial_port port6(ioc_ex, native_port2);
- #if defined(BOOST_ASIO_HAS_MOVE)
- serial_port port7(std::move(port6));
- #endif // defined(BOOST_ASIO_HAS_MOVE)
- // basic_serial_port operators.
- #if defined(BOOST_ASIO_HAS_MOVE)
- port1 = serial_port(ioc);
- port1 = std::move(port2);
- #endif // defined(BOOST_ASIO_HAS_MOVE)
- // basic_io_object functions.
- serial_port::executor_type ex = port1.get_executor();
- (void)ex;
- // basic_serial_port functions.
- serial_port::lowest_layer_type& lowest_layer = port1.lowest_layer();
- (void)lowest_layer;
- const serial_port& port8 = port1;
- const serial_port::lowest_layer_type& lowest_layer2 = port8.lowest_layer();
- (void)lowest_layer2;
- port1.open("null");
- port1.open("null", ec);
- serial_port::native_handle_type native_port3 = port1.native_handle();
- port1.assign(native_port3);
- serial_port::native_handle_type native_port4 = port1.native_handle();
- port1.assign(native_port4, ec);
- bool is_open = port1.is_open();
- (void)is_open;
- port1.close();
- port1.close(ec);
- serial_port::native_handle_type native_port5 = port1.native_handle();
- (void)native_port5;
- port1.cancel();
- port1.cancel(ec);
- port1.set_option(serial_port_option);
- port1.set_option(serial_port_option, ec);
- port1.get_option(serial_port_option);
- port1.get_option(serial_port_option, ec);
- port1.send_break();
- port1.send_break(ec);
- port1.write_some(buffer(mutable_char_buffer));
- port1.write_some(buffer(const_char_buffer));
- port1.write_some(buffer(mutable_char_buffer), ec);
- port1.write_some(buffer(const_char_buffer), ec);
- port1.async_write_some(buffer(mutable_char_buffer), write_some_handler());
- port1.async_write_some(buffer(const_char_buffer), write_some_handler());
- int i1 = port1.async_write_some(buffer(mutable_char_buffer), lazy);
- (void)i1;
- int i2 = port1.async_write_some(buffer(const_char_buffer), lazy);
- (void)i2;
- port1.read_some(buffer(mutable_char_buffer));
- port1.read_some(buffer(mutable_char_buffer), ec);
- port1.async_read_some(buffer(mutable_char_buffer), read_some_handler());
- int i3 = port1.async_read_some(buffer(mutable_char_buffer), lazy);
- (void)i3;
- }
- catch (std::exception&)
- {
- }
- #endif // defined(BOOST_ASIO_HAS_SERIAL_PORT)
- }
- } // namespace serial_port_compile
- //------------------------------------------------------------------------------
- BOOST_ASIO_TEST_SUITE
- (
- "serial_port",
- BOOST_ASIO_TEST_CASE(serial_port_compile::test)
- )
